Kaniūkai is a village in Buivydžių sen., Vilnius and has about 48 residents. Kaniūkai is situated nearby to the hamlet Veselucha, as well as near the village Išoriškės.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Buivydžiai is a village in Vilnius District Municipality, Lithuania. According to the 2011 census, it had 272 residents. It is located some 17 kilometres east of Nemenčinė and 3 kilometres west of the state border with Belarus.
